import React from 'react'
import { ColorExtractor } from 'react-color-extractor'
import generateColors from 'randomcolor'
import { TinyColor } from '@ctrl/tinycolor'
import Values from 'values.js'
import PropTypes from 'prop-types'
import styled from 'react-emotion'
import clipboard from 'clipboard-polyfill'
import ColorInput from '../components/ColorInputField'
import ColorBlock from '../components/ColorBlock'
import Container from '../components/Container'
import Image from '../components/Image'
import Swatches from '../components/Swatches'
import Triangle from '../components/Triangle'
import ColorFormatPicker from '../components/ColorFormatPicker'
import { AdvanceTools, BasicTools } from '../components/Tools'
import { Provider as ColorProvider } from '../utils/context'
import {
DEFAULT_SWATCHES,
DEFAULT_COLOR,
COLOR_CONTAINER_WIDTH,
MAX_COLORS
} from '../utils/constants'
import getThemeVariants from '../utils/theme'
const StyledList = styled('ul')`
display: grid;
justify-content: center;
grid-template-columns: 1fr;
grid-gap: 15px;
list-style: none;
margin-left: -28px;
`
const ToolsContainer = styled('div')`
display: grid;
grid-template-columns: ${props =>
`repeat(${props.columns || 6}, ${props.size || '1fr'})`};
grid-gap: ${props => props.gap || '5px'};
margin-right: -20px;
margin-top: 20px;
`
export default class BasicPicker extends React.PureComponent {
// Image upload icon
imageIcon = null
// Hidden input element for uploading an image
uploadElement = null
// Clipboard icon
clipboardIcon = null
state = {
// Current block, active and input field color (or hue)
color: new TinyColor(this.props.color),
// Current swatches to be displayed in picker
swatches: this.props.swatches,
// Image from which colors are extracted
image: null,
// Shades are the hue darkened with black
shades: [],
// Tints are the hue lightend with white
tints: [],
// Should display the shades swatches
showShades: false,
// Should display the tint swatches
showTints: false,
// Current color format selected
currentFormat: 'HEX',
// Color format options
formats: ['HEX', 'HSV', 'RGB', 'HSL'],
// Color manipulation values
// Brightens the currently selected color by an amount
brighten: 0,
// Darkens the currently selected color by an amount
darken: 0,
// spin operation spins (changes) the current hue
spin: 0,
// desaturation makes a color more muted (with black or grey)
desaturate: 0,
// saturation controls the intensity (or purity) of a color
saturate: 0,
// Show or hide color copied msg
showMsg: false
}
static defaultProps = {
color: DEFAULT_COLOR,
swatches: DEFAULT_SWATCHES,
// Max amount of colors from which palettes will be generated (from the image)
maxColors: MAX_COLORS,
triangle: true,
theme: 'light',
// Color tools are disabled by default
showTools: false
}
static propTypes = {
color: PropTypes.string,
/* eslint-disable react/require-default-props */
onChange: PropTypes.func,
onSwatchHover: PropTypes.func,
swatches: PropTypes.arrayOf(PropTypes.string),
maxColors: PropTypes.number,
triangle: PropTypes.bool,
theme: PropTypes.oneOf(['light', 'dark']),
showTools: PropTypes.bool
}
// Instance properties are used to store the color state on
// which the color operations will be applied.
brightenColor = null
darkenColor = null
spinColor = null
desaturateColor = null
saturateColor = null
componentDidMount() {
this.uploadElement = document.getElementById('uploader')
this.imageIcon = document.getElementById('image-icon')
this.clipboardIcon = document.getElementById('clipboard')
this.imageIcon &&
this.imageIcon.addEventListener('click', this.simulateClick)
this.clipboardIcon &&
this.clipboardIcon.addEventListener('mouseleave', this.hideMsg)
this.clipboardIcon &&
this.clipboardIcon.addEventListener('blur', this.hideMsg)
// Attach a listener for deleting the image (if any) from the color block
document.addEventListener('keydown', this.updateKey)
}
componentDidUpdate(prevProps) {
if (prevProps.color !== this.props.color) {
const color = new TinyColor(this.props.color)
// Check if its a valid hex and then update the color
// on changing the color input field, it only updates the color block if the hex code is valid
if (color.isValid) {
this.setState({ color })
}
}
}
componentWillUnmount() {
this.imageIcon &&
this.imageIcon.removeEventListener('click', this.simulateClick)
this.clipboardIcon &&
this.clipboardIcon.removeEventListener('mouseleave', this.hideMsg)
this.clipboardIcon &&
this.clipboardIcon.removeEventListener('blur', this.hideMsg)
document.removeEventListener('keydown', this.updateKey)
}
hideMsg = () => this.setState({ showMsg: false })
// default onChange handler for color input field
defaultOnChange = color => {
const newColor = new TinyColor(color)
if (newColor.isValid) {
this.setState({ color: newColor })
}
}
updateColorState = (value, color, operation) => {
const newValue = parseInt(value)
const newColor = new TinyColor(color)[operation](newValue)
this.props.onChange && this.props.onChange(newColor.toHexString())
this.setState({ [operation]: newValue, color: newColor })
}
clearAllColorBuffers = () => {
this.spinColor = null
this.saturateColor = null
this.desaturateColor = null
this.darkenColor = null
this.brightenColor = null
}
/**
* Below methods are used to handle color operations. Whenever an
* operation is performed on a color, it mutates the original state
* of the color. So we use instance properties to clear and set the
* currently active color state, and then apply the color operations
* w.r.t to the instance property (or current color value)
*
* TODO: Refactor this mess
*/
handleSpin = e => {
if (this.spinColor === null) {
this.spinColor = this.state.color.originalInput
}
this.saturateColor = null
this.desaturateColor = null
this.brightenColor = null
this.darkenColor = null
this.updateColorState(e.target.value, this.spinColor, 'spin')
}
handleSaturate = e => {
if (this.saturateColor === null) {
this.saturateColor = this.state.color.originalInput
}
this.spinColor = null
this.desaturateColor = null
this.brightenColor = null
this.darkenColor = null
this.updateColorState(e.target.value, this.saturateColor, 'saturate')
}
handleDesaturate = e => {
if (this.desaturateColor === null) {
this.desaturateColor = this.state.color.originalInput
}
this.saturateColor = null
this.spinColor = null
this.brightenColor = null
this.darkenColor = null
this.updateColorState(e.target.value, this.desaturateColor, 'desaturate')
}
handleBrighten = e => {
if (this.brightenColor === null) {
this.brightenColor = this.state.color.originalInput
}
this.saturateColor = null
this.desaturateColor = null
this.spinColor = null
this.darkenColor = null
this.updateColorState(e.target.value, this.brightenColor, 'brighten')
}
handleDarken = e => {
if (this.darkenColor === null) {
this.darkenColor = this.state.color.originalInput
}
this.saturateColor = null
this.desaturateColor = null
this.brightenColor = null
this.spinColor = null
this.updateColorState(e.target.value, this.darkenColor, 'darken')
}
// outputs the color according to the color format
getColor = color => ({
HSL: color.toHslString(),
HEX: color.toHexString(),
RGB: color.toRgbString(),
HSV: color.toHsvString()
})
// This handler is used to update the image state. After the colors
// are extracted from the image, a image can be removed from the color block.
updateKey = e => {
if (e.which === 8) {
// Remove the image from color block
this.setState({ image: null })
}
}
simulateClick = e => {
if (this.uploadElement) {
this.uploadElement.click()
}
e.preventDefault()
}
// Randomly generate new swatches
generateSwatches = () => {
let i = 0
// Each swatch should be different
const newColors = new Set()
while (i < 12) {
newColors.add(generateColors())
i += 1
}
const swatches = Array.from(newColors)
// Hide shades and tints when new swatches are added
this.setState({
swatches: [...swatches],
showShades: false,
showTints: false,
tints: [],
shades: []
})
}
uploadImage = e =>
this.setState({ image: window.URL.createObjectURL(e.target.files[0]) })
// Updates the hue state
updateSwatch = color => {
// If tools are active, then reset color instance properties.
if (this.props.showTools) {
this.clearAllColorBuffers()
this.setState({
color: new TinyColor(color),
// Reset all the values for the newly selected swatch
spin: 0,
saturate: 0,
desaturate: 0,
darken: 0,
brighten: 0
})
} else {
this.setState({
color: new TinyColor(color)
})
}
this.props.onChange && this.props.onChange(color)
}
// Handler to update swatches when colors are extracted from an image
updateSwatches = swatches =>
this.setState({
swatches: [...swatches],
// Also update the current color
color: new TinyColor(swatches[0]),
// Hide the shades and tints
showShades: false,
showTints: false,
tints: [],
shades: []
})
// Generates shades or tints from the currently selected hue (color)
generateSwatchesFromHue = (term, showShades, showTints) => {
const colorBuffer = []
const color = new Values(this.state.color.toHexString())
color[term]().forEach(c => colorBuffer.push(c.hexString()))
this.setState({
[term]: [...colorBuffer],
showShades,
showTints
})
}
// Shades - A hue lightened with white
generateShades = () => this.generateSwatchesFromHue('shades', true, false)
// Tints - A hue darkened with black
generateTints = () => this.generateSwatchesFromHue('tints', false, true)
// Update the color format (hsv, rgb, hex, or hsl)
changeFormat = e => this.setState({ currentFormat: e.target.value })
// Reset the shades and tints, and displays the previous swatches
resetColors = () =>
this.setState({
shades: [],
tints: [],
showShades: false,
showTints: false
})
copyColor = () => {
const { color, currentFormat } = this.state
const activeColor = this.getColor(color)[currentFormat]
clipboard.writeText(activeColor)
this.setState({ showMsg: true })
}
render() {
const {
image,
swatches,
shades,
showShades,
showTints,
tints,
currentFormat,
darken,
brighten,
spin,
desaturate,
saturate,
formats
} = this.state
// Get the color string with a specified color format
const color = this.getColor(this.state.color)[currentFormat]
const { bg, iconColor } = getThemeVariants(this.props.theme)
return (
<Container background={bg} width={COLOR_CONTAINER_WIDTH}>
{/* eslint-disable operator-linebreak */}
{/* eslint-disable indent */}
{this.props.triangle &&
image === null && <Triangle color={this.state.color.toHexString()} />}
{image === null ? (
<ColorBlock
colorState={this.state.color}
color={color}
currentFormat={currentFormat}
/>
) : (
<Image src={image} />
)}
{image && (
<ColorExtractor
maxColors={this.props.maxColors}
src={image}
getColors={this.updateSwatches}
/>
)}
<div style={{ padding: 10 }}>
{showShades ? (
<Swatches
swatches={shades}
updateSwatch={this.updateSwatch}
onSwatchHover={this.props.onSwatchHover}
/>
) : showTints ? (
<Swatches
swatches={tints}
updateSwatch={this.updateSwatch}
onSwatchHover={this.props.onSwatchHover}
/>
) : (
<Swatches
swatches={swatches}
updateSwatch={this.updateSwatch}
onSwatchHover={this.props.onSwatchHover}
/>
)}
<ColorInput
value={color}
onChange={this.props.onChange || this.defaultOnChange}
/>
<ColorFormatPicker
changeFormat={this.changeFormat}
formats={formats}
/>
<ColorProvider value={iconColor}>
<ToolsContainer>
<BasicTools.ImagePicker uploadImage={this.uploadImage} />
<BasicTools.PaletteGenerator
generateSwatches={this.generateSwatches}
/>
<BasicTools.TintsGenerator generateTints={this.generateTints} />
<BasicTools.ShadesGenerator
generateShades={this.generateShades}
/>
<BasicTools.Clipboard
copyColor={this.copyColor}
showMsg={this.state.showMsg}
/>
<BasicTools.Reset resetColors={this.resetColors} />
</ToolsContainer>
</ColorProvider>
{this.props.showTools ? (
<div>
<ColorProvider value={iconColor}>
<StyledList>
<li>
<AdvanceTools.ColorSpinner
value={spin}
onChange={this.handleSpin}
/>
</li>
<li>
<AdvanceTools.ColorSaturator
value={saturate}
onChange={this.handleSaturate}
/>
</li>
<li>
<AdvanceTools.ColorDesaturator
value={desaturate}
onChange={this.handleDesaturate}
/>
</li>
<li>
<AdvanceTools.ColorDarkener
value={darken}
onChange={this.handleDarken}
/>
</li>
<li>
<AdvanceTools.ColorBrightener
value={brighten}
onChange={this.handleBrighten}
/>
</li>
</StyledList>
</ColorProvider>
</div>
) : null}
</div>
</Container>
)
}
}
